Distance from Delhi to Lansdowne, Uttarakhand

The distance from Delhi to Lansdowne Uttarakhand is approximately 250 kilometers. This journey can be covered by various means of transportation including car, bus, and train. Each mode of transport offers a unique experience and allows travelers to enjoy the scenic beauty of the route.

Best Routes to Lansdowne from Delhi

By Car

Traveling by car is one of the most convenient ways to reach Lansdowne from Delhi. The road trip offers a chance to enjoy the beautiful landscapes and quaint towns along the way. The most popular route is via NH534 and NH334, which takes about 6 to 7 hours, depending on traffic conditions. Here is a detailed breakdown of the route:

  1. Delhi to Meerut: Start your journey from Delhi and head towards Meerut via the Meerut Bypass Road. This stretch is about 70 kilometers and takes around 1.5 to 2 hours.
  2. Meerut to Bijnor: From Meerut, continue towards Bijnor, which is approximately 90 kilometers away. This part of the journey takes around 2 to 2.5 hours.
  3. Bijnor to Kotdwar: Next, drive towards Kotdwar, which is about 70 kilometers from Bijnor. This segment of the journey takes approximately 1.5 to 2 hours.
  4. Kotdwar to Lansdowne: The final stretch from Kotdwar to Lansdowne is about 40 kilometers and takes around 1 to 1.5 hours. The road winds through lush greenery and offers stunning views of the surrounding hills.

By Bus

For those who prefer public transportation, taking a bus is a viable option. Several state-run and private buses operate between Delhi and Lansdowne. The journey by bus typically takes around 7 to 8 hours. Buses usually depart from ISBT Kashmere Gate in Delhi and drop passengers off at Kotdwar, from where you can take a local taxi or bus to Lansdowne.

By Train

Traveling by train is another comfortable option for reaching Lansdowne. The nearest railway station to Lansdowne is Kotdwar, which is well-connected to Delhi by several trains. The journey by train takes around 6 to 7 hours. Some popular trains include the Mussoorie Express and Garhwal Express. From Kotdwar, Lansdowne is just a 40-kilometer drive away, which can be covered by taxi or local bus.

Places to Visit in Lansdowne

Bhulla Tal Lake

Bhulla Tal Lake is a beautiful man-made lake and a popular attraction in Lansdowne. The serene environment, coupled with boating facilities, makes it a perfect spot for a relaxing day out. The lake is surrounded by lush greenery and is an excellent place for photography enthusiasts.

Tip-In-Top Point

Tip-In-Top Point, also known as Tiffin Top, offers a breathtaking view of the surrounding Himalayan ranges. It is one of the highest points in Lansdowne and provides an excellent vantage point for witnessing stunning sunrises and sunsets. The viewpoint is easily accessible by foot and is a must-visit for nature lovers.

St. John’s Church

St. John’s Church is a historic church built during the British era. The church is known for its beautiful architecture and serene environment. It is a great place to spend some quiet time and soak in the peaceful atmosphere of Lansdowne.

War Memorial

The War Memorial in Lansdowne is dedicated to the brave soldiers of the Garhwal Rifles. Located at the Parade Ground, the memorial is a significant landmark and offers insights into the rich history and valor of the regiment. The site is well-maintained and is a source of pride for the locals.

Kalagarh Tiger Reserve

For wildlife enthusiasts, a visit to the Kalagarh Tiger Reserve is a must. The reserve is part of the Corbett National Park and offers a chance to spot various wildlife species, including tigers, leopards, and deer. The reserve is located about 13 kilometers from Lansdowne and can be reached by a short drive.

Things to Do in Lansdowne

Trekking and Nature Walks

Lansdowne is a paradise for trekking enthusiasts. The region offers several trekking trails that pass through dense forests, quaint villages, and beautiful streams. Nature walks are also popular, allowing visitors to explore the rich flora and fauna of the area.

Boating at Bhulla Tal Lake

Boating at Bhulla Tal Lake is a peaceful and enjoyable experience. Visitors can rent paddle boats and rowboats to explore the calm waters of the lake. The surrounding area is well-maintained, making it a great spot for picnics and relaxation.

Bird Watching

Lansdowne is home to a variety of bird species, making it a haven for bird watchers. The region’s diverse ecosystem supports both resident and migratory birds. Some popular spots for bird watching include Bhulla Tal Lake and the surrounding forest areas.

Camping

Camping is a popular activity in Lansdowne, offering a chance to connect with nature. Several campsites are available where visitors can set up tents and enjoy a night under the stars. Camping is an excellent way to experience the natural beauty and tranquility of the region.

Best Time to Visit Lansdowne

Lansdowne can be visited throughout the year, but the best time to visit is from March to November. During these months, the weather is pleasant, and the natural beauty of the region is at its peak. Summers are ideal for sightseeing and outdoor activities, while the monsoon season adds a lush green charm to the landscape. Winters are cold, but the snowfall makes Lansdowne look like a winter wonderland.
